- android - 多次调用 OnPrimaryClipChangedListener
- android - 无法更新 RecyclerView 中的 TextView 字段
- android.database.CursorIndexOutOfBoundsException : Index 0 requested, 光标大小为 0
- android - 使用 AppCompat 时,我们是否需要明确指定其 UI 组件(Spinner、EditText)颜色
我是新来的,你好。
我正在使用 ASP.NET 4,并且正在使用 LINQ to SQL 作为我的数据控件。根据建议,我创建了一个 DBML(LINQ to SQL 类项),然后从 SQL Server 拖到相关表上。然后我在我的代码中使用这个 DBML 和 LINQ 即:
using (ProjectDataContext Data = new ProjectDataContext())
{
Order MyOrder = new Order();
}
这一切都很好。我现在遇到了 SQLMetal。我看不到这个工具的相关性,我是否遗漏了什么?
谢谢,
埃德
最佳答案
当您使用向导从 SQL 中拖出表时,它又会为您生成对象,因此不需要 SQLMetal。
SQLMetal 是一个命令行工具,您可以使用它来从 linq 到 sql 生成这些对象,但是将它们拖放到向导中要容易得多。它还有其他用途。有关引用,请参见此处:http://msdn.microsoft.com/en-us/library/bb386987.aspx
关于c# - 我可以在 VC2010 中很好地设置 LINQ to SQL,那么为什么 SQLMetal 相关?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/10012029/
我需要定期刷新我的 Linq To SQL 类;是的,我为没有足够彻底地考虑我的数据模式而感到羞耻,糟糕的开发人员,广告恶心。我发现 SQLMetal 几乎可以解决问题,但也许我从参数列表中遗漏了一些
是否可以为 sqlmetal.exe 生成的所有部分类添加命名空间?我可以手动执行此操作,但希望它自动化。 最佳答案 使用 /namespace运行时的标志 sqlmetal , MSDN 前任: s
编辑 - 清理问题以更好地反射(reflect)实际问题: 我正在使用 SQLMetal 从我们的 SQL Server db 生成数据库类。最近,我需要添加一个有多个外键指向同一个表的表。使用 LI
当 Visual Studio 自动生成 dbml 文件时,我得到了表中出现的确切字段名称。 但是,由于VS不提供dbml刷新功能,所以我手动运行sqlmetal来重新创建dbml文件。它工作得很好,
我使用 SQLMetal 生成了代表我的数据库的代码文件,但我不知道如何从 SQLMetal 生成的类中向数据库添加条目。我该怎么做呢?我只是添加到各种属性还是什么? 最佳答案 这是 linq-to-
嗨,有一个存储过程,它总是根据参数返回单行: IF @bleh = 1 SELECT TOP 1 Xyz FROM Abc ELSE SELECT TOP 1 Def FROM Abc 我必须
错误信息: Warning : SQM1014: Unable to extract function 'dbo.ProductFamilyIndex_EN' from SqlServer. Null
由于我不想讨论的原因,我们的主数据库架构目前仅位于 SQL Azure 中。我们正在努力使用 Enzo Backup 之类的工具将其本地化(我们正在等待他们的开发人员修复我们在尝试下载时遇到的一些错误
我正在尝试使用新的 Mono 2.6 SqlMetal 工具为简单的 Sqlite 数据库创建 DBML 文件。该架构非常简单,如下所示: CREATE TABLE Tags ( Id
我正在为数据库生成 LINQ-to-SQL DataContext 和实体类。数据库有几个表,其中两个是 - [AccountMaster] 和 [AccountCodes]。它们之间定义了一个外键关
我在尝试更新外键字段时遇到问题: record.ForeignId = newId; 由于抛出 System.Data.Linq.ForeignKeyReferenceAlreadyHasValueE
我想使用 sqlmetal 为我的项目生成 dbml 数据上下文,但数据上下文和创建的所有类都标记为 public。因为这应该是一个 API 层,所以我想改为将其中许多类或至少上下文本身标记为 int
我在 Mac OS 上使用 Mono/MonoDevelop,我想要一个使用 SqlMetal(Mono 附带的 DbLinq 版本)的示例,用于 LINQ-to-SQL 和 MySQL 数据库。 奇
在生成 Linq2SQL 模型时,我过去更喜欢使用 SqlMetal,而不是 Visual Studio 中的 OR 设计器。 所以,我的问题是:是否有相当于 SqlMetal 的工具用于生成 EF4
我在 WebMatrix 中创建了一个使用 SQL Server CE 4.0 的小型测试项目。由于不喜欢使用嵌入式 SQL,我想为 WebMatrix 生成的 SQL Server CE 4.0 数
我正在尝试从 Linux 上的现有 PostgreSql 数据库为 Linq(或 Entity Framework 6)生成 c# 类。我在一个 monodevelop 项目中安装了 npgsql 和
如标题所述,我是否正在尝试使用 SQLMetal 创建一个 dbml 文件。此操作的背景是创建一个 C#-Codefile,其中包含所有表、函数、 View 、存储过程等,以便在 MVC 应用程序 中
我正在创建一个小型数据库应用程序来自学以下概念 C# 编程 .Net 3.5 框架 WPF LINQ ORM 我想使用 Microsoft Access 作为数据库,但我似乎找不到任何关于是否可以使用
我是新来的,你好。 我正在使用 ASP.NET 4,并且正在使用 LINQ to SQL 作为我的数据控件。根据建议,我创建了一个 DBML(LINQ to SQL 类项),然后从 SQL Serve
我想使用新的 Sql datetime2 数据类型进行事件记录(因为标准日期时间的精度低于 System.DateTime,导致存储时数据丢失)但是当我使用 sqlmetal.exe 生成代码,但收到
我是一名优秀的程序员,十分优秀!